Port of CIGADING

IDCIG🇮🇩Indonesia

Also known as: Pelabuhan Cigading

Cigading is a harbor in Banten, Indonesia. It is equipped with pilotage and tug services.

How do I navigate the approach to the Port of CIGADING?+
The approach to CIGADING is supported by 5 navigation aids within 50 nautical miles. The nearest is Pulau Ular Lighthouse at 1.8 NM to the W. Other aids include Cilegon City Lighthouses (3.3 NM NE), Cikoneng (5.7 NM SW), Panto Binuangen (6.5 NM SW), Pulau Sangiang (6.6 NM WNW). Mariners should consult the relevant chart and List of Lights for full approach details.
